Output 51009d3e6d58011db29c080e406b689133a7257ce01a2411aac7fa74309098fc:16

value
608000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c805c1899af49407e9b33a263a9d9cb5196cb2f8 OP_EQUAL
address
3Kvdxquwr9kphz4PUPtGbCmVD7hyQjZkTx
transaction
51009d3e6d58011db29c080e406b689133a7257ce01a2411aac7fa74309098fc
spent
true